Transaction

67fd5a2dba62addcee68ad00b110b4a152e8a9aa3d87f43398c84c253f88c2f1
419,036 confirmations
Timestamp
1523938701
Block518,569
Fee22,753 sats
Fee rate10.2 sats/vB
view on mempool.space

Inputs & Outputs

Outputs